Complete with Street legal Kit. Includes DNA Racing 17" Front and Rear(black hubs, KTM org spokes, black rims, polished nipps), Akrapovic Slip On, Regina Gold Chain, Hand Guards. This thing will do it all, urban, track, off road. The stock off road kit is available with the machine. Ready to bolt on, you get 2 bikes in one! $9999+FEES, TTL.CALL CYCLE TOWN SOUTH TODAY!

2014 KTM 1290 Super Duke R Revealed

Tue, 01 Oct 2013

Almost a year after it was revealed in prototype form, KTM has released final specifications and photographs of the all-new 1290 Super Duke R production model. Until now, KTM had been coy about the specs for its large-displacement naked bike, but we can now see what makes the Austrian manufacturer nickname the new Super Duke R as “the Beast”. In typical KTM style, the 1290 in the bike’s name provides only a ballpark estimate of the actual engine displacement.

Day 9 Dakar 2014: Coma Wins, Increases Overall Lead

Tue, 14 Jan 2014

The ninth stage took the field to the northernmost point of this year’s Dakar. The riders descended from yesterday’s plateau through the Atacama desert towards the Pacific Ocean. Sand and dunes challenged the athletes especially in the final third of the stage, demanding excellent navigation skills.
